http://www.morpc.org/energy/center/WaterQuality.asp WebThe Division of Sewerage and Drainage operates two wastewater treatment plants, Jackson Pike and Southerly. Wastewater from Columbus and 25 contracting suburban communities flows to one of these two plants, who combined treated an average of 188 million gallons per day in 2024, a year with rainfall of 44".

Miranda Gray - South … pbl hisspbl hotcopperWebThe Appalachian Ohio Watershed Council (AOWC) is a collaborative group of agencies, nonprofits, interest groups, companies, and individuals. We gather quarterly throughout the year to share updates, strategies, and resources.
